如何通过数据增强提升智能对话模型效果
在人工智能领域,智能对话模型已经成为了研究的热点。这类模型能够理解和生成自然语言,为用户提供便捷的交互体验。然而,在实际应用中,智能对话模型的效果往往受到数据集质量、模型复杂度等因素的影响。为了提升智能对话模型的效果,数据增强技术应运而生。本文将讲述一位数据增强专家的故事,探讨如何通过数据增强提升智能对话模型效果。
这位数据增强专家名叫李明,毕业于我国一所知名大学计算机科学与技术专业。毕业后,他加入了一家专注于人工智能领域的企业,从事智能对话模型的研究与开发。在多年的工作中,李明发现智能对话模型在实际应用中存在以下问题:
数据集质量不高:由于实际应用场景复杂,收集到的数据往往存在噪声、缺失和偏差等问题,导致模型效果不佳。
数据量不足:高质量的数据往往难以获取,导致模型训练过程中无法充分学习到数据特征。
数据分布不均:数据集中某些类别样本数量过多,而其他类别样本数量过少,导致模型在预测过程中出现偏差。
为了解决这些问题,李明开始研究数据增强技术。数据增强是一种通过人工或算法手段,对原始数据进行变换、扩充,从而提高数据集质量和数量的方法。以下是李明在数据增强方面的一些实践:
数据清洗:对原始数据进行清洗,去除噪声、缺失和偏差,提高数据质量。
数据扩充:通过对原始数据进行变换、合成等方式,增加数据量。例如,对文本数据进行同义词替换、句子结构调整等操作。
数据重采样:对数据集进行重采样,使得不同类别样本数量趋于均衡,避免模型在预测过程中出现偏差。
数据迁移学习:利用已有的高质量数据集,对目标数据集进行迁移学习,提高模型效果。
在李明的努力下,数据增强技术在智能对话模型中的应用取得了显著成效。以下是他总结的一些关键经验:
数据增强方法的选择:根据具体应用场景和数据特点,选择合适的数据增强方法。例如,对于文本数据,可以使用同义词替换、句子结构调整等方法;对于图像数据,可以使用旋转、缩放、裁剪等方法。
数据增强参数的调整:在数据增强过程中,需要调整参数以控制增强效果。例如,对于同义词替换,可以调整替换比例;对于图像旋转,可以调整旋转角度。
数据增强与模型训练的结合:在模型训练过程中,将数据增强与模型训练相结合,提高模型对数据变化的适应性。
数据增强的评估:在数据增强过程中,需要对增强效果进行评估,以确保数据增强的合理性。
通过李明的实践,我们了解到数据增强技术在提升智能对话模型效果方面具有重要作用。以下是一些具体案例:
在某智能客服系统中,通过数据增强技术,将数据集规模扩大了10倍,使得模型在客服场景下的准确率提高了20%。
在某智能语音助手系统中,通过数据增强技术,使得模型在语音识别任务中的准确率提高了15%。
总之,数据增强技术在提升智能对话模型效果方面具有显著作用。在实际应用中,我们需要根据具体场景和数据特点,选择合适的数据增强方法,并结合模型训练进行优化。相信在不久的将来,数据增强技术将为智能对话模型的发展带来更多可能性。
猜你喜欢:智能语音机器人